From: Ankit Nautiyal Date: Fri, 19 Dec 2025 06:02:59 +0000 (+0530) Subject: drm/i915/gvt/display_helper: Get rid of #ifdef/#undefs X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=a2e3dda51d550f4226a3e490469fde469ee57189;p=thirdparty%2Fkernel%2Flinux.git drm/i915/gvt/display_helper: Get rid of #ifdef/#undefs Now that i915/display macros have been substituted with wrappers that call the new display-device helpers, we can drop the conflicting includes from GVT and remove the temporary #ifdef/#undef macro overrides. Signed-off-by: Ankit Nautiyal Reviewed-by: Jani Nikula Link: https://patch.msgid.link/20251219060302.2365123-7-ankit.k.nautiyal@intel.com --- diff --git a/drivers/gpu/drm/i915/gvt/cmd_parser.c b/drivers/gpu/drm/i915/gvt/cmd_parser.c index fbc8a5e28576..e5301733f4e4 100644 --- a/drivers/gpu/drm/i915/gvt/cmd_parser.c +++ b/drivers/gpu/drm/i915/gvt/cmd_parser.c @@ -53,7 +53,6 @@ #include "trace.h" #include "display/i9xx_plane_regs.h" -#include "display/intel_display_core.h" #include "display/intel_sprite_regs.h" #include "gem/i915_gem_context.h" #include "gem/i915_gem_pm.h" diff --git a/drivers/gpu/drm/i915/gvt/display_helpers.h b/drivers/gpu/drm/i915/gvt/display_helpers.h index d0975ed507d3..0418397c09c4 100644 --- a/drivers/gpu/drm/i915/gvt/display_helpers.h +++ b/drivers/gpu/drm/i915/gvt/display_helpers.h @@ -8,15 +8,9 @@ #include "display/intel_gvt_api.h" -#ifdef DISPLAY_MMIO_BASE -#undef DISPLAY_MMIO_BASE -#endif #define DISPLAY_MMIO_BASE(display) \ intel_display_device_mmio_base((display)) -#ifdef INTEL_DISPLAY_DEVICE_PIPE_OFFSET -#undef INTEL_DISPLAY_DEVICE_PIPE_OFFSET -#endif /* * #FIXME: * TRANSCONF() uses pipe-based addressing via _MMIO_PIPE2(). @@ -30,15 +24,9 @@ #define INTEL_DISPLAY_DEVICE_PIPE_OFFSET(display, idx) \ intel_display_device_pipe_offset((display), (enum pipe)(idx)) -#ifdef INTEL_DISPLAY_DEVICE_TRANS_OFFSET -#undef INTEL_DISPLAY_DEVICE_TRANS_OFFSET -#endif #define INTEL_DISPLAY_DEVICE_TRANS_OFFSET(display, trans) \ intel_display_device_trans_offset((display), (trans)) -#ifdef INTEL_DISPLAY_DEVICE_CURSOR_OFFSET -#undef INTEL_DISPLAY_DEVICE_CURSOR_OFFSET -#endif #define INTEL_DISPLAY_DEVICE_CURSOR_OFFSET(display, pipe) \ intel_display_device_cursor_offset((display), (pipe)) diff --git a/drivers/gpu/drm/i915/gvt/fb_decoder.c b/drivers/gpu/drm/i915/gvt/fb_decoder.c index c402f3b5a0ab..3d1a7e5c8cd3 100644 --- a/drivers/gpu/drm/i915/gvt/fb_decoder.c +++ b/drivers/gpu/drm/i915/gvt/fb_decoder.c @@ -43,7 +43,6 @@ #include "display/i9xx_plane_regs.h" #include "display/intel_cursor_regs.h" -#include "display/intel_display_core.h" #include "display/intel_sprite_regs.h" #include "display/skl_universal_plane_regs.h" #include "display_helpers.h" diff --git a/drivers/gpu/drm/i915/gvt/handlers.c b/drivers/gpu/drm/i915/gvt/handlers.c index 9ada97d01b6c..7063d3c77562 100644 --- a/drivers/gpu/drm/i915/gvt/handlers.c +++ b/drivers/gpu/drm/i915/gvt/handlers.c @@ -49,7 +49,6 @@ #include "display/i9xx_plane_regs.h" #include "display/intel_crt_regs.h" #include "display/intel_cursor_regs.h" -#include "display/intel_display_core.h" #include "display/intel_display_types.h" #include "display/intel_dmc_regs.h" #include "display/intel_dp_aux_regs.h"